如何理解WordPress網(wǎng)站中的用戶角色及其權(quán)限設(shè)置?
WordPress作為一個強大的內(nèi)容管理系統(tǒng),提供了靈活的用戶角色和權(quán)限管理功能。了解這些角色及其權(quán)限設(shè)置對于網(wǎng)站的安全性和有效管理至關(guān)重要。本文將詳細介紹WordPress的用戶角色體系,幫助您更好地管理您的網(wǎng)站。
WordPress默認用戶角色
WordPress默認提供了五種用戶角色,每種角色都有特定的權(quán)限和職責:
- 超級管理員:在多站點網(wǎng)絡(luò)中擁有最高權(quán)限,可以管理整個網(wǎng)絡(luò)。
- 管理員:單個站點的最高權(quán)限,可以進行所有管理操作。
- 編輯:可以管理和發(fā)布所有文章,包括其他用戶的文章。
- 作者:可以發(fā)布和管理自己的文章。
- 投稿者:可以寫文章,但需要管理員審核后才能發(fā)布。
- 訂閱者:只能管理自己的個人資料。
用戶角色權(quán)限詳解
不同的用戶角色擁有不同的權(quán)限,這些權(quán)限決定了用戶可以在WordPress網(wǎng)站上執(zhí)行哪些操作:
- 管理員可以安裝插件、更改主題、管理用戶等。
- 編輯可以管理分類、標簽,以及編輯其他用戶的文章。
- 作者可以上傳媒體文件,并管理自己的文章。
- 投稿者只能寫文章和編輯自己未發(fā)布的文章。
- 訂閱者僅能閱讀文章和管理個人資料。
自定義用戶角色和權(quán)限
除了默認角色,WordPress還允許網(wǎng)站管理員創(chuàng)建自定義角色和修改現(xiàn)有角色的權(quán)限。這可以通過以下方式實現(xiàn):
- 使用插件如User Role Editor或Members來創(chuàng)建和管理自定義角色。
- 通過編碼方式,使用WordPress的Roles API來定義新角色或修改現(xiàn)有角色的權(quán)限。
權(quán)限設(shè)置最佳實踐
合理設(shè)置用戶角色和權(quán)限可以提高網(wǎng)站的安全性和管理效率:
- 遵循最小權(quán)限原則,只給用戶必要的權(quán)限。
- 定期審核用戶角色,確保每個用戶都有合適的權(quán)限。
- 使用強密碼政策,并啟用雙因素認證。
- 為特定任務(wù)創(chuàng)建自定義角色,而不是過度授權(quán)。
結(jié)語
理解和正確設(shè)置WordPress的用戶角色及權(quán)限是網(wǎng)站管理的重要組成部分。通過合理分配權(quán)限,您可以提高網(wǎng)站的安全性,簡化工作流程,并確保每個團隊成員都能高效地完成自己的任務(wù)。隨著網(wǎng)站的發(fā)展,定期審查和調(diào)整用戶角色設(shè)置將有助于維護一個安全、高效的WordPress網(wǎng)站。